Phone number ☎️ 0215255300 👆 is reported as a nuisance and potential scammer, frequently calling with offers of vouchers or cash prizes that require personal and bank details. Many users express concern about unauthorized charges and pressure to provide contacts for lucky draws, indicating it may be a phishing attempt. Responses range from blocking the number to worries over financial security after sharing sensitive information. Overall, it appears to be an intrusive and untrustworthy caller, with advice to avoid engagement and safeguard personal data.
